Global legal technology consultancy eSentio Technologies has hired Todd Parkin as associate director of document management systems. Parkin will be joining Mike Georgopoulos‘ team, bringing extensive expertise in large scale technology initiatives and complex project delivery.
Parkin brings extensive experience from his 14-year tenure at Kraft Kennedy, where he progressed through multiple senior roles, culminating as director of pre-sales engineering. During his time there, he spearheaded the development of new product and service offerings, including cloud migration and data center infrastructure optimization.
Parkin said: “I’m very familiar with the unique challenges faced by global firms when implementing enterprise-scale solutions and I look forward to helping our clients navigate their technology transformation journeys while ensuring seamless execution and exceptional business outcomes.”
In his new role, Parkin will lead strategic consulting initiatives including NetDocuments implementation and complex technology transformations.
Georgopoulos, who is director of DMS and network information services at eSentio, said: “Todd’s expertise in change management and his ability to exceed client expectations align perfectly with our commitment to being trusted advisors for large, global law firms.”
This appointment follows eSentio’s very recent hire of Andy Ward as global director of information governance. Ward has two decades of experience across law firms, software companies, and consulting businesses, including senior roles at Kroll and Nuix. Specializing in the Microsoft tech stack, including Azure and Purview, he has experience working with generative AI-powered tools across DMS solutions, eDiscovery platforms, and information governance.
